What is the Order of Operations?

Back

The Order of Operations is a set of rules that determines the sequence in which calculations are performed in a mathematical expression. The common acronym to remember this is PEMDAS: Parentheses, Exponents, Multiplication and Division (from left to right), Addition and Subtraction (from left to right).

What does PEMDAS stand for?

Back

PEMDAS stands for: P - Parentheses, E - Exponents, MD - Multiplication and Division (from left to right), AS - Addition and Subtraction (from left to right).

What is the first step in solving the expression 5 + 3 x 2?

Back

The first step is to perform the multiplication: 3 x 2 = 6, then add 5 + 6 = 11.

Solve the expression: 8 - 2 + 4.

Back

First, subtract: 8 - 2 = 6, then add: 6 + 4 = 10.
